Sunday Evening Update on Positive COVID-19 Cases

Potsdam Campus Community,

We want to again thank everyone for working together this weekend while St. Lawrence County Public Health responded to three positive cases of COVID-19 identified Friday evening on our campus.  We have had no more positive COVID-19 tests results returned.

Please come together to wish our three positive cases a good recovery.  And also as importantly, please be considerate and accommodating of the 78 members of our campus community who are in a status of isolation, quarantine and precautionary quarantine based on contact tracing and local public health following the NYS guidelines.  The health and safety of everyone in our campus community is our highest priority and these steps are important towards stopping the spread of the virus as well as the prevention steps we have been posting.

We need everyone to not go to class or participate in campus activities if you have a fever of 100.4* or greater, cough, shortness of breath or difficulty breathing, chills, muscle pain, sore throat, or new loss of taste or smell.  If these symptoms occur, please contact Campus Safety at 315-268-6666, and a staff member there will connect you 24/7 with the appropriate resource for evaluation and testing.

Please follow the health and safety protocols to wear a mask over the nose and mouth; practice social distancing; practice good personal hygiene and again, and act any signs of COVID-19 as noted above.
